Company Registration in Bangladesh for Foreign Defence Firms

Foreign defence companies wishing to establish a legal entity in Bangladesh must register with the Registrar of Joint Stock Companies and Firms and obtain the necessary regulatory approvals for their specific business activity. The process involves preparation of articles of association, appointment of directors, opening a bank account and obtaining a trade licence. Trade Licence and Business Permit Assistance

A trade licence issued by the relevant city corporation or municipality is a basic operational requirement for any business entity in Bangladesh and must be renewed annually. Specific business activities in the defence and pharmaceutical sector require additional permits from sector regulators. Banking and Financial Setup Advisory

Opening a corporate bank account, establishing foreign currency accounts, arranging letters of credit for import transactions and setting up the payment infrastructure for a Bangladesh operation all require navigation of Bangladesh Bank's foreign exchange regulations. Local Partnership and Agent Agreement Structuring

The structure of the commercial agreement between a foreign defence company and its Bangladeshi agent or local partner significantly affects the success of the relationship and must be carefully designed to align incentives and protect both parties' interests. Agreement terms covering territory, exclusivity, commission structure, performance obligations, IP protection and termination conditions must all be addressed.
